		<description><![CDATA[Al Reis came up with a great list of branding &#8216;musts&#8217; that can help you as you work through branding your ministry.
1. Expansion
The power of a brand is inversely proportional to its scope
2. Contraction
A brand becomes stronger when you narrow its focus
3. Publicity
The birth of a brand is achieved with publicity, not advertising
4. Advertising

		<description><![CDATA[The benefits of having a strong brand are tremendous. Strong brands charge premium pricing; they thrive during economic downturns; they attract great employees, partners and customers; and they can extend into new business areas with ease.

What is a brand?
Brand is the proprietary visual, emotional, rational, and cultural image that you associate with a company or a product. When you think Volvo, you might think safety.
